The Hedgerow Hut is a gorgeous, designer built, self contained cabin, with unhindered views of The Preseli Hills in Pembrokeshire's Coast National Park. Located right at the field side, so you can enjoy watching foxes, badgers, red kites, buzzards, the hay making or even sheep!
This is a perfect getaway for two, imagine retreating for a romantic few days, the smell of the bbq, a gentle stroll up a nearby hill, or shoes off on the beach as the tide comes in. Hedgerow Hut is open plan, with an adventurous double bed on a deck, accessed by ladder, where you can view the world through the glass front of the cabin. The deck also rises to make even more room. Two sofas convert to beds if you don't feel so nimble, or if 3 or 4 of you share the cabin. There is a well equipped decent size kitchen area and a BBQ is available. The shower/toilet is a separate en-suite design. - (it will sleep four at a push, but you want really good weather and harmonious, easy going friends for that!!)
As well as inside seats, there is ample outside seating, to enjoy that evening glass of wine, or even the morning cuppa. A very quiet hideaway to do absolutely nothing, or fully explore the natural beauty of our coastline, hills or the neolithic heritage of the blue stones. Come, unwind and be refreshed, soak in the views of the highest point in the Preseli Hills from your chair or even from bed!!

Located in Clynderwen, this cabin is in a rural area. Pentre Ifan Dolmen and Newport Memorial Hall are local landmarks, and some of the area's activities can be experienced at Bluestone Brewing Co. and Steep Ravine. Moorland Cottage Plants and Holgan Farm Fishery are also worth visiting. Make sure you get close to the area's animals with activities such as game walks and birdwatching.
